Cybersecurity Training:
In an increasingly digital world, cybersecurity training has become a paramount concern for organizations. With the rise in cyber threats and data breaches, it is essential for companies to prioritize comprehensive cybersecurity training programs. Such training initiatives educate employees about crucial aspects such as data privacy, recognizing phishing attempts, and implementing secure practices. By equipping employees with the knowledge and skills to identify potential threats and vulnerabilities, organizations can protect sensitive information and mitigate risks. Cybersecurity training fosters a culture of awareness and vigilance, ensuring that employees understand the importance of maintaining robust security measures in their day-to-day activities. By investing in cybersecurity training, organizations fortify their defenses, safeguard sensitive data, and maintain the trust of their customers and stakeholders.

Implementing Effective Corporate Training Programs
To ensure the effectiveness of corporate training programs, organizations should consider the following strategies:
Assessing Training Needs:
To ensure effective training programs, it is crucial to assess the training needs within the organization. Conducting a thorough assessment allows for the identification of skills gaps and specific training requirements. This assessment can be achieved through various methods such as surveys, performance evaluations, and gathering feedback from employees and managers. Surveys provide valuable insights into employees' perceptions of their skills and knowledge gaps.
Performance evaluations offer a comprehensive review of individual strengths and areas for improvement. Feedback from employees and managers can provide valuable firsthand insights into the specific training needs and areas that require attention. By conducting a robust assessment, organizations can tailor their training initiatives to address the specific needs of their workforce, ensuring targeted and impactful learning experiences.

Utilizing Interactive And Engaging Methods:
To enhance the effectiveness of training programs, incorporating interactive and engaging methods is crucial. By integrating elements like group activities, simulations, case studies, and gamification, the training becomes more immersive and memorable. These interactive elements encourage active participation from participants, fostering a dynamic learning environment. Engaging methods also promote knowledge retention as learners are actively involved in applying concepts and problem-solving.
Group activities encourage collaboration and teamwork, while simulations and case studies provide real-life scenarios for practical application. Gamification adds an element of fun and competition, further motivating participants to actively engage with the training material. By utilizing interactive and engaging methods, organizations create impactful learning experiences that leave a lasting impression on participants.
Tracking And Evaluating Training Outcomes:
Tracking and evaluating training outcomes is essential for assessing the success of Leadership Training Programs. By establishing metrics such as post-training assessments, performance indicators, and participant feedback, organizations can measure the effectiveness of their training initiatives. Regular evaluation allows for identifying areas that require improvement and fine-tuning the training content and delivery methods.
Additionally, tracking training outcomes enables organizations to measure the return on investment (ROI) of their training programs, ensuring that the resources invested in employee development yield tangible results. By monitoring and evaluating training outcomes, organizations can continuously improve their training efforts and ensure that they align with their overall goals and objectives.
Overcoming Challenges in Corporate Training
Implementing updated corporate training programs can be accompanied by several challenges:
Resistance To Change:
Resistance to change is a common challenge when implementing new training initiatives. Employees may exhibit resistance due to fear of the unknown or a reluctance to step out of their comfort zones. To overcome this resistance, it is important to address concerns and communicate the benefits of the training. Providing clear explanations of how the training will enhance their skills, boost their career prospects, or improve job satisfaction can help alleviate fears and encourage buy-in.?
Additionally, involving employees in the planning and decision-making process and fostering an open and supportive environment can help create a sense of ownership and engagement. By addressing resistance to change, organizations can successfully implement training programs and empower employees to embrace new learning opportunities.
Time Constraints And Scheduling:
Balancing training with regular work responsibilities can be a daunting task due to time constraints. Employees often face challenges in finding dedicated time for training activities. To address this issue, organizations can offer flexible training options that accommodate employees' schedules. Online modules or blended learning approaches provide the flexibility for individuals to learn at their own pace and access training materials conveniently.?
By allowing employees to engage in Transformational Leadership Training at their preferred time and location, organizations facilitate a better work-life balance and remove barriers to participation. Flexible training options empower employees to take control of their learning journey and ensure that professional development can be seamlessly integrated into their daily work routines.
Cost Considerations:
While implementing training programs incurs costs, the long-term benefits of having a skilled and knowledgeable workforce far outweigh the initial expenses. To address cost considerations, organizations can explore cost-effective training solutions. This may include leveraging technology, such as online training platforms or virtual classrooms, which can significantly reduce training expenses without compromising the quality of learning.?
Additionally, organizations can consider alternative training methods, such as peer-to-peer mentoring or cross-departmental knowledge sharing, which often incur fewer costs. By carefully evaluating and selecting cost-effective training approaches, organizations can strike a balance between maximizing the development of their employees and managing their budget effectively.
